Output 6ecdc6e2d6831d655855ea8df80bb2198c644f042a1025fa59a71309d3cdf2e2:4

value
466982
script pubkey
OP_0 OP_PUSHBYTES_20 18feec6245f6a56654489f5463324be4d8a2c2fc
address
bc1qrrlwccj976jkv4zgna2xxvjtunv29shuj5jfc3
transaction
6ecdc6e2d6831d655855ea8df80bb2198c644f042a1025fa59a71309d3cdf2e2
confirmations
22394
spent
true